Ludhiana: The civic body has sent samples collected after treatment near Jamalpur sewerage treatment plant (STP) at Buddha Nullah. The civic body has started treatment of water being thrown inside drain after passing through STP to improve BOD in drain water. A chemical called sodium aluminium hydrochloride is being used for treatment in STP. The officials have claimed that the sewerage water that is being released into Buddha Nullah after treatment is of improved quality.
Mayor Balkar Singh Sandhu had also visited Jamalpur STP on Tuesday evening to review the ongoing progress. He said he is satisfied with the results, but claimed that long-term impact of the chemical should be checked. He claimed that they need to check whether it will create impact on Satluj when drain water will mix with river water. He also claimed that Satluj water is being used for irrigation and drinking purpose at many places so they cannot use anything that can prove harmful later on. The mayor claimed that after test reports are awaited be able to reach any conclusion.
